@albrownwood
The log level of switch use CONFIG_LOG_DEFAULT_LEVEL_NONE=y as default, so there isn't any LOG output. you can check the function by the LOG of bulb:

I (5161) app_bulb: bind, uuid: 08:f9:e0:1f:9d:34, initiator_type: 513
I (17901) app_bulb: app_bulb_ctrl_data_cb, initiator_attribute: 513, responder_attribute: 1, value: 1
I (19171) app_bulb: app_bulb_ctrl_data_cb, initiator_attribute: 513, responder_attribute: 1, value: 0
I (28411) app_bulb: app_bulb_ctrl_data_cb, initiator_attribute: 513, responder_attribute: 1, value: 1
I (29931) app_bulb: app_bulb_ctrl_data_cb, initiator_attribute: 513, responder_attribute: 1, value: 0
I (31281) app_bulb: app_bulb_ctrl_data_cb, initiator_attribute: 513, responder_attribute: 1, value: 1

Of course, please change it to CONFIG_LOG_DEFAULT_LEVEL_INFO=y if you want to show the LOG of switch, then you will see the LOG of switch as follows:

I (3981) app_switch: switch bind press
I (4000) espnow_ctrl: src_addr: 24:0a:c4:03:f5:14, espnow_ctrl_initiator_ack, channel: 1
I (6251) app_switch: switch send press
I (6289) espnow_ctrl: src_addr: 24:0a:c4:03:f5:14, espnow_ctrl_initiator_ack, channel: 1
I (9891) app_switch: switch send press
I (9911) espnow_ctrl: src_addr: 24:0a:c4:03:f5:14, espnow_ctrl_initiator_ack, channel: 1
I (12196) app_switch: switch send press
I (12267) espnow_ctrl: src_addr: 24:0a:c4:03:f5:14, espnow_ctrl_initiator_ack, channel: 1
